The book, Stormchaser, is the sequel to Beyond the Deepwoods. The story continues with Twig and his father, Cloud Wolf, sailing into Undertown, the only real city in the Edge. It lies in the shadow of Sanctaphrax, the academic town on top of a giant floating rock. To keep Sanctaphrax from floating away, it needs stormphrax, a heavy substance created by lightning. An evil scholar once made a substance that can turn any water clean from crushing stormphrax, but no one has ever been able to make more. People keep trying to make it with stolen stormphrax, therefore threatening Sanctaphrax with floating away! Twig and his father are sent secretly to find more stormphrax to keep Sanctaphrax from floating away. To find out what happens to Twig and the rest of his fathers crew, read the book.

Opinion: 

This book was just as good as its prequel. It was a page-turner, had a good plot, ended with enough suspense to get you waiting for its sequel, and had just the right amount of surprises and mysteries. Again I would recommend it to anyone who likes fantasy, action, mystery, or drama in books. This was another great overall book.
